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Support
Keyboard shortcuts
?
Submit feedback
Contribute to GitLab
Sign in / Register
Toggle navigation
M
MariaDB
Project overview
Project overview
Details
Activity
Releases
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Issues
0
Issues
0
List
Boards
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Analytics
Analytics
CI / CD
Repository
Value Stream
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
nexedi
MariaDB
Commits
5bf14f93
Commit
5bf14f93
authored
7 years ago
by
Aleksey Midenkov
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
Tests: fix combinations
parent
68e160fb
Changes
28
Hide whitespace changes
Inline
Side-by-side
Showing
28 changed files
with
47 additions
and
320 deletions
+47
-320
mysql-test/suite/versioning/common.inc
mysql-test/suite/versioning/common.inc
+2
-0
mysql-test/suite/versioning/common.opt
mysql-test/suite/versioning/common.opt
+0
-16
mysql-test/suite/versioning/engines.combinations
mysql-test/suite/versioning/engines.combinations
+0
-0
mysql-test/suite/versioning/engines.inc
mysql-test/suite/versioning/engines.inc
+1
-0
mysql-test/suite/versioning/innodb.inc
mysql-test/suite/versioning/innodb.inc
+0
-0
mysql-test/suite/versioning/innodb.opt
mysql-test/suite/versioning/innodb.opt
+16
-0
mysql-test/suite/versioning/r/rpl.result
mysql-test/suite/versioning/r/rpl.result
+0
-0
mysql-test/suite/versioning/r/rpl_row.result
mysql-test/suite/versioning/r/rpl_row.result
+0
-118
mysql-test/suite/versioning/r/rpl_stmt.result
mysql-test/suite/versioning/r/rpl_stmt.result
+0
-118
mysql-test/suite/versioning/t/create.test
mysql-test/suite/versioning/t/create.test
+2
-1
mysql-test/suite/versioning/t/partition.combinations
mysql-test/suite/versioning/t/partition.combinations
+0
-7
mysql-test/suite/versioning/t/partition.opt
mysql-test/suite/versioning/t/partition.opt
+1
-0
mysql-test/suite/versioning/t/rpl.opt
mysql-test/suite/versioning/t/rpl.opt
+0
-0
mysql-test/suite/versioning/t/rpl.test
mysql-test/suite/versioning/t/rpl.test
+18
-0
mysql-test/suite/versioning/t/rpl_mixed.combinations
mysql-test/suite/versioning/t/rpl_mixed.combinations
+0
-5
mysql-test/suite/versioning/t/rpl_mixed.test
mysql-test/suite/versioning/t/rpl_mixed.test
+0
-7
mysql-test/suite/versioning/t/rpl_row.combinations
mysql-test/suite/versioning/t/rpl_row.combinations
+0
-5
mysql-test/suite/versioning/t/rpl_row.test
mysql-test/suite/versioning/t/rpl_row.test
+0
-7
mysql-test/suite/versioning/t/rpl_stmt.combinations
mysql-test/suite/versioning/t/rpl_stmt.combinations
+0
-5
mysql-test/suite/versioning/t/rpl_stmt.test
mysql-test/suite/versioning/t/rpl_stmt.test
+0
-7
mysql-test/suite/versioning/t/select.combinations
mysql-test/suite/versioning/t/select.combinations
+0
-5
mysql-test/suite/versioning/t/select.test
mysql-test/suite/versioning/t/select.test
+2
-1
mysql-test/suite/versioning/t/select_sp.combinations
mysql-test/suite/versioning/t/select_sp.combinations
+0
-5
mysql-test/suite/versioning/t/select_sp.test
mysql-test/suite/versioning/t/select_sp.test
+2
-1
mysql-test/suite/versioning/t/truncate.combinations
mysql-test/suite/versioning/t/truncate.combinations
+0
-5
mysql-test/suite/versioning/t/truncate.test
mysql-test/suite/versioning/t/truncate.test
+1
-1
mysql-test/suite/versioning/t/view.combinations
mysql-test/suite/versioning/t/view.combinations
+0
-5
mysql-test/suite/versioning/t/view.test
mysql-test/suite/versioning/t/view.test
+2
-1
No files found.
mysql-test/suite/versioning/common.inc
View file @
5bf14f93
--
disable_query_log
--
source
suite
/
versioning
/
innodb
.
inc
set
@@
session
.
time_zone
=
'+00:00'
;
select
ifnull
(
max
(
transaction_id
),
0
)
into
@
start_trx_id
from
mysql
.
transaction_registry
;
set
@
test_start
=
now
(
6
);
...
...
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/common.opt
View file @
5bf14f93
--innodb
--innodb-cmpmem
--innodb-cmp-per-index
--innodb-trx
--innodb-locks
--innodb-metrics
--innodb-buffer-pool-stats
--innodb-buffer-page
--innodb-buffer-page-lru
--innodb-sys-columns
--innodb-sys-fields
--innodb-sys-foreign
--innodb-sys-foreign-cols
--innodb-sys-indexes
--innodb-sys-tables
--innodb-sys-virtual
--versioning-hide=implicit
--plugin-load=versioning
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/
t/create
.combinations
→
mysql-test/suite/versioning/
engines
.combinations
View file @
5bf14f93
File moved
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/engines.inc
0 → 100644
View file @
5bf14f93
--
source
suite
/
versioning
/
innodb
.
inc
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/innodb.inc
0 → 100644
View file @
5bf14f93
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/innodb.opt
0 → 100644
View file @
5bf14f93
--innodb
--innodb-cmpmem
--innodb-cmp-per-index
--innodb-trx
--innodb-locks
--innodb-metrics
--innodb-buffer-pool-stats
--innodb-buffer-page
--innodb-buffer-page-lru
--innodb-sys-columns
--innodb-sys-fields
--innodb-sys-foreign
--innodb-sys-foreign-cols
--innodb-sys-indexes
--innodb-sys-tables
--innodb-sys-virtual
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/r/rpl
_mixed
.result
→
mysql-test/suite/versioning/r/rpl.result
View file @
5bf14f93
File moved
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/r/rpl_row.result
deleted
100644 → 0
View file @
68e160fb
include/master-slave.inc
[connection master]
connection slave;
connection master;
CREATE TABLE t1 (x int) with system versioning;
insert into t1 values (1);
SELECT * FROM t1;
x
1
delete from t1;
select * from t1;
x
select * from t1 for system_time all;
x
1
connection slave;
select * from t1;
x
select * from t1 for system_time all;
x
1
connection master;
insert into t1 values (2);
connection slave;
select * from t1;
x
2
connection master;
update t1 set x = 3;
connection slave;
select * from t1;
x
3
select * from t1 for system_time all;
x
1
3
2
connection master;
create or replace table t1 (x int primary key);
connection slave;
alter table t1 with system versioning;
connection master;
insert into t1 values (1);
connection slave;
select * from t1;
x
1
select * from t1 for system_time all;
x
1
connection master;
update t1 set x= 2 where x = 1;
connection slave;
select * from t1;
x
2
select * from t1 for system_time all;
x
1
2
connection master;
delete from t1;
connection slave;
select * from t1;
x
select * from t1 for system_time all;
x
1
2
connection master;
create or replace table t1 (x int);
connection slave;
alter table t1 with system versioning;
connection master;
insert into t1 values (1);
update t1 set x= 2 where x = 1;
connection slave;
select * from t1;
x
2
select * from t1 for system_time all;
x
2
1
connection master;
delete from t1;
connection slave;
select * from t1;
x
select * from t1 for system_time all;
x
2
1
connection master;
create or replace table t1 (x int) with system versioning;
create or replace table t2 (x int) with system versioning;
insert into t1 values (1);
insert into t2 values (2);
update t1, t2 set t1.x=11, t2.x=22;
connection slave;
select * from t1;
x
11
select * from t2;
x
22
select * from t1 for system_time all;
x
11
1
select * from t2 for system_time all;
x
22
2
connection master;
drop table t1, t2;
include/rpl_end.inc
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/r/rpl_stmt.result
deleted
100644 → 0
View file @
68e160fb
include/master-slave.inc
[connection master]
connection slave;
connection master;
CREATE TABLE t1 (x int) with system versioning;
insert into t1 values (1);
SELECT * FROM t1;
x
1
delete from t1;
select * from t1;
x
select * from t1 for system_time all;
x
1
connection slave;
select * from t1;
x
select * from t1 for system_time all;
x
1
connection master;
insert into t1 values (2);
connection slave;
select * from t1;
x
2
connection master;
update t1 set x = 3;
connection slave;
select * from t1;
x
3
select * from t1 for system_time all;
x
1
3
2
connection master;
create or replace table t1 (x int primary key);
connection slave;
alter table t1 with system versioning;
connection master;
insert into t1 values (1);
connection slave;
select * from t1;
x
1
select * from t1 for system_time all;
x
1
connection master;
update t1 set x= 2 where x = 1;
connection slave;
select * from t1;
x
2
select * from t1 for system_time all;
x
1
2
connection master;
delete from t1;
connection slave;
select * from t1;
x
select * from t1 for system_time all;
x
1
2
connection master;
create or replace table t1 (x int);
connection slave;
alter table t1 with system versioning;
connection master;
insert into t1 values (1);
update t1 set x= 2 where x = 1;
connection slave;
select * from t1;
x
2
select * from t1 for system_time all;
x
2
1
connection master;
delete from t1;
connection slave;
select * from t1;
x
select * from t1 for system_time all;
x
2
1
connection master;
create or replace table t1 (x int) with system versioning;
create or replace table t2 (x int) with system versioning;
insert into t1 values (1);
insert into t2 values (2);
update t1, t2 set t1.x=11, t2.x=22;
connection slave;
select * from t1;
x
11
select * from t2;
x
22
select * from t1 for system_time all;
x
11
1
select * from t2 for system_time all;
x
22
2
connection master;
drop table t1, t2;
include/rpl_end.inc
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/create.test
View file @
5bf14f93
--
source
suite
/
versioning
/
common
.
inc
--
source
suite
/
versioning
/
engines
.
inc
--
source
suite
/
versioning
/
common
.
inc
--
disable_warnings
drop
table
if
exists
t1
;
...
...
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/partition.combinations
deleted
100644 → 0
View file @
68e160fb
# [innodb]
# partition
# default-storage-engine=innodb
[myisam]
partition
default-storage-engine=myisam
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/partition.opt
View file @
5bf14f93
--partition
--versioning-hide=implicit
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/rpl
_test
.opt
→
mysql-test/suite/versioning/t/rpl.opt
View file @
5bf14f93
File moved
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/rpl
_test.inc
→
mysql-test/suite/versioning/t/rpl
.test
View file @
5bf14f93
--
source
include
/
master
-
slave
.
inc
if
(
$MTR_COMBINATION_STMT
)
{
--
source
include
/
have_binlog_format_statement
.
inc
}
if
(
$MTR_COMBINATION_ROW
)
{
--
source
include
/
have_binlog_format_row
.
inc
}
if
(
$MTR_COMBINATION_MIX
)
{
--
source
include
/
have_binlog_format_mixed
.
inc
}
--
source
suite
/
versioning
/
engines
.
inc
#BUG#12662190 - COM_COMMIT IS NOT INCREMENTED FROM THE BINARY LOGS ON SLAVE, COM_BEGIN IS
#Testing command counters -BEFORE.
#Storing the before counts of Slave
...
...
@@ -88,3 +104,5 @@ select * from t2 for system_time all;
connection
master
;
drop
table
t1
,
t2
;
--
source
include
/
rpl_end
.
inc
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/rpl_mixed.combinations
deleted
100644 → 0
View file @
68e160fb
[myisam]
default-storage-engine=myisam
[innodb]
default-storage-engine=innodb
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/rpl_mixed.test
deleted
100644 → 0
View file @
68e160fb
--
source
include
/
have_binlog_format_mixed
.
inc
--
source
include
/
master
-
slave
.
inc
--
source
include
/
have_innodb
.
inc
--
source
rpl_test
.
inc
--
source
include
/
rpl_end
.
inc
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/rpl_row.combinations
deleted
100644 → 0
View file @
68e160fb
[myisam]
default-storage-engine=myisam
[innodb]
default-storage-engine=innodb
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/rpl_row.test
deleted
100644 → 0
View file @
68e160fb
--
source
include
/
have_binlog_format_row
.
inc
--
source
include
/
master
-
slave
.
inc
--
source
include
/
have_innodb
.
inc
--
source
rpl_test
.
inc
--
source
include
/
rpl_end
.
inc
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/rpl_stmt.combinations
deleted
100644 → 0
View file @
68e160fb
[innodb]
default-storage-engine=innodb
[myisam]
default-storage-engine=myisam
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/rpl_stmt.test
deleted
100644 → 0
View file @
68e160fb
--
source
include
/
have_binlog_format_statement
.
inc
--
source
include
/
master
-
slave
.
inc
--
source
include
/
have_innodb
.
inc
--
source
rpl_test
.
inc
--
source
include
/
rpl_end
.
inc
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/select.combinations
deleted
100644 → 0
View file @
68e160fb
[innodb]
default-storage-engine=innodb
[myisam]
default-storage-engine=myisam
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/select.test
View file @
5bf14f93
--
source
suite
/
versioning
/
common
.
inc
--
source
suite
/
versioning
/
engines
.
inc
--
source
suite
/
versioning
/
common
.
inc
# test_01
...
...
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/select_sp.combinations
deleted
100644 → 0
View file @
68e160fb
[innodb]
default-storage-engine=innodb
[myisam]
default-storage-engine=myisam
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/select_sp.test
View file @
5bf14f93
--
source
suite
/
versioning
/
common
.
inc
--
source
suite
/
versioning
/
engines
.
inc
--
source
suite
/
versioning
/
common
.
inc
delimiter
~~
;
create
procedure
test_01
()
...
...
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/truncate.combinations
deleted
100644 → 0
View file @
68e160fb
[innodb]
default-storage-engine=innodb
[myisam]
default-storage-engine=myisam
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/truncate.test
View file @
5bf14f93
--
source
include
/
have_innodb
.
inc
--
source
suite
/
versioning
/
engines
.
inc
create
table
t
(
a
int
);
--
error
ER_VERSIONING_REQUIRED
...
...
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/view.combinations
deleted
100644 → 0
View file @
68e160fb
[innodb]
default-storage-engine=innodb
[myisam]
default-storage-engine=myisam
This diff is collapsed.
Click to expand it.
mysql-test/suite/versioning/t/view.test
View file @
5bf14f93
--
source
suite
/
versioning
/
common
.
inc
--
source
suite
/
versioning
/
engines
.
inc
--
source
suite
/
versioning
/
common
.
inc
create
or
replace
table
t1
(
x
int
)
with
system
versioning
;
insert
into
t1
values
(
1
);
...
...
This diff is collapsed.
Click to expand it.
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ment